Questions to Ask an Agent Before Listing in O'Connor
Before you sign with an agent, ask:
-
What’s included in your commission?
-
How long are your average days on market?
-
Can you provide recent local sales results?
-
What’s your marketing plan for homes in O'Connor?
-
Are your fees negotiable?

Frequently Asked Questions
Q: What is the average real estate agent commission in O'Connor?
In O'Connor, commission rates typically vary from agent to agent. The exact figure depends on the agent, property type, and level of service. It’s always worth negotiating and comparing local agents before making a decision.
Q: Are real estate agent fees negotiable in O'Connor?
Yes. Most agents are open to negotiation, especially if your property is highly desirable, or you’re considering a tiered commission structure. Asking the right questions and comparing options can save you thousands.
Q: How much does it cost to sell a house in O'Connor?
Beyond commission, you should budget for marketing (photography, online ads, brochures), styling, and conveyancing/legal fees. On average, sellers in O'Connor can spend between $6,000 and $12,000 on these extras.
Q: What are the risks of choosing the cheapest agent?
The lowest-fee agent isn’t always the best choice. An experienced agent with strong negotiation skills may secure a higher sale price that more than offsets their higher commission. Cheap fees can sometimes mean reduced service, limited marketing, or less experience and a lower sale price.
Q: Do I need professional styling or photography for my O'Connor property?
While not mandatory, professional styling and photography can in some cases increase buyer interest and boost sale prices. In suburbs like O'Connor, it might be a worthwhile investment.

About O'Connor (WA 6163)
O'Connor is a predominantly industrial suburb of Perth, Western Australia, located within the City of Fremantle. It was established in 1955 and is named after the Irish engineer, C.Y. O'Connor, who is buried in Fremantle Cemetery. O'Connor has a roller skating rink plus a number of retail store; A major hardware store, 2 major electronics retailers, a tyre store, several automotive parts and accessory stores, a popular bicycle store, a furniture store and numerous other retail stores. There are quite a number of light industrial activities taking place in the suburb, the most prominent of which is the Anchor Cordial Operations on Carrington Street. There are 2 precincts of residential dwellings which contain a small but growing number of dwellings. O'Connor is also an electoral division in Western Australia.
The suburb of O'Connor was named in 1955 in honour of Charles Yelverton O'Connor. O'Connor was Engineer in Chief and General Manager of the Railways of Western Australia in the 1890's, and is remembered for his genius that resulted in construction of the Goldfields Water Supply, Fremantle Harbour and Perth's suburban rail system. He died in 1903
